你查询的IP:[119.80.75.86]  地理位置:中国–北京–北京

最新查询119.232.126.107 119.232.166.95 202.28.110.26 218.192.3.187 123.64.191.229 118.24.201.30 124.47.77.114 211.64.236.162 116.248.196.188 119.80.75.86 119.60.73.194 202.91.176.110 120.64.58.33 119.42.224.46 203.142.219.170 202.124.24.91 124.108.40.68 124.40.112.69 121.4.93.19 202.150.16.205 122.248.48.215 122.48.26.66 125.62.161.176 202.4.252.224 121.59.79.162 59.191.239.113 117.53.176.176 116.199.128.205 221.176.117.172 117.48.179.121 210.5.144.147